History and Development

The Batavia Public Library was founded in 1885, with a collection of just 500 books. Over the years, the library has undergone several expansions and renovations, with the most recent being the construction of a new building in 2002. The new facility features a spacious reading area, a children’s section, a teen zone, and a community room, providing ample space for patrons to explore and learn.

Collection and Services

The Batavia Public Library boasts a collection of over 150,000 items, including books, audiobooks, e-books, DVDs, CDs, and digital media. The library also offers a variety of services, such as free Wi-Fi, computer access, printing and scanning, and interlibrary loan. Patrons can also take advantage of the library’s online resources, including databases, e-books, and streaming services.

💡 The Batavia Public Library is a member of the Reaching Across Illinois Library System (RAILS), which provides access to a shared catalog and delivery system, allowing patrons to borrow materials from other libraries in the system.

Programs and Events

The Batavia Public Library offers a wide range of programs and events for all ages, including author readings, book clubs, children’s storytime, and teen activities. The library also partners with local organizations to provide educational and cultural programs, such as STEM workshops, art exhibits, and concert series.

Children’s Services

The Batavia Public Library has a dedicated children’s section, featuring a play area, a storytime room, and a collection of picture books, early readers, and juvenile fiction. The library also offers children’s programs, such as storytime, craft sessions, and movie nights, designed to promote literacy and a love of reading in young children.

The library's summer reading program is a popular event, encouraging children to read and explore new books during the summer months. The program includes activities, games, and prizes, making reading a fun and rewarding experience for kids.

Technology and Accessibility

The Batavia Public Library is committed to providing accessible technology and resources to its patrons. The library offers assistive technology, such as text-to-speech software and magnification tools, to support users with disabilities. The library also provides wireless printing and mobile hotspots for checkout, making it easy for patrons to access the internet and print documents on the go.
